Transaction 3d250751295cec44659bd8d40bffe0ddc07da359d6de3c836123115429fbd51a
1 Input
1 Output
-
3d250751295cec44659bd8d40bffe0ddc07da359d6de3c836123115429fbd51a:0
- value
- 898196
- script pubkey
- OP_0 OP_PUSHBYTES_20 3dee9efdcc7232891871bb98de811d656ca4bcb5
- address
- bc1q8hhfalwvwgegjxr3hwvdaqgav4k2f0944zu7xu